Subject: PointsKeeper ledger — 4.2 release

Team, the PointsKeeper loyalty-points ledger now writes accrual and redemption entries atomically, closing the double-credit gap from 4.1. Migration backfills balances overnight; no manual steps. Future maintainers: the reconciliation job is idempotent, so reruns are safe. For auditing this release against the artifact store, use the build token recorded below.

build token for haduf-bafog: htk21_2d98ce91a83676b65394a

- [ ] Step 7: Archive cold storage buckets (Glacierline tier). Confirm both ceremony witnesses are present, verify bucket manifests match the Oxbow ledger, then seal the archive key shares. Plugin authors may observe but not handle shares. Once sealed, the archive index itself is encrypted and can only be reopened with the passphrase below.

vault phrase of badup-hahig = tamael-aldael-kelmir-istael-fenok-istwyn-tamius-jorath-oliion

Subject: Renewal of Quillbrook Logistics Agreement

Executive team,

Finance has completed its review of the Quillbrook Logistics renewal. The proposed three-year term includes a 2.8% annual escalator, improved fuel-surcharge caps, and quarterly true-ups, which together reduce projected freight variance materially. We recommend approval before the current agreement lapses in November. Cash impact modeling is attached for the finance team. The confidential note below summarizes the strategic rationale.

board note of tawig-bajof: The renewal with Ralixix Holdings closes at $10 million a year, 20 percent above the last contract. Project Druix slips by two quarters because of the tooling delay.

// Webhook delivery retry semantics for the Oxtail dispatcher.
// Retries use capped exponential backoff with full jitter; signatures are
// recomputed per attempt so replayed payloads cannot reuse stale HMACs.
// Delivery is abandoned after the attempt cap and quarantined for audit.
// No secrets are logged at any retry stage. Tuning values are defined below.

tuning constants:
QUOTAS = {
    "druwyn": 5,
    "holix": 5,
    "zorath": 5,
    "holwyn": 10,
}